8 inch carbon steel pipe Specification
| Pipe Size | OD | ID | Schedules | Wall | Est. LBS per Ft(Steel Pipe) |
| 8″ | 8.623″ | 8.323″ | 10, 10S | 0.15″ | 13.316 |
| 7.977″ | 40, STD, 40S | 0.323″ | 28.147 | ||
| 7.623″ | 80, XS, 80S | 0.5″ | 42.663 | ||
| 6.803″ | 160 | 0.91″ | 73.41 | ||
| 6.875″ | XXS | 0.874″ | 71.144 |

8 inch carbon steel pipe Mechanical Properties
General Mechanical Properties for ASTM A106 Grade B Carbon Steel Pipe (3/4 inch):
Tensile Strength:
Minimum: 60,000 psi (415 MPa)
Yield Strength:
Minimum: 35,000 psi (240 MPa)
Elongation:
Minimum: 20% in 2 inches (for smaller diameters, such as 8 inch, the elongation requirement may be adjusted slightly).
Hardness:
Not specifically defined in the standard, but generally, carbon steel of this grade has a Brinell Hardness (HBW) of around 120-180.
Impact Resistance:
Typically measured by Charpy V-Notch test for applications requiring toughness, especially at lower temperatures. For ASTM A106, impact testing may be required if used in low-temperature environments, though it’s not a general requirement for standard applications.
Modulus of Elasticity:
Approximate: 29,000,000 psi (200 GPa)
8 inch carbon steel pipe Material Specifications
Seamless carbon steel pipe for high temperature and high pressure applications: ASTM A106/A106M
Seamless and welded carbon steel pipe for normal temperature applications: ASTM A53/A53M
Seamless and welded carbon steel pipe for low temperature services: ASTM A333/A333M
Alloy steel pipe for high temperature applications: ASTM A335/A335M
8 inch carbon steel pipe Applications
1. Oil and Gas Transportation: They are commonly used in the oil and gas industry to transport crude oil, natural gas, and refined petroleum products over long distances. They are also used in refineries and other processing facilities.
2. Water and Wastewater Treatment: They are used in water and wastewater treatment plants to transport water, wastewater, and sludge. They are also used in irrigation systems and other water supply applications.
3. Power Generation: They are used in power plants to transport steam, water, and other fluids. They are also used in cooling systems and heat exchangers.
4. Chemical Processing: They are suitable for chemical processing plants exposed to corrosive chemicals. They are used to transport a variety of chemicals, acids, and bases.
5. Construction: They are widely used in construction projects such as bridges, buildings, and roads. They are used for structural support, piling, and scaffolding.
6. Automotive Industry: They are used in the automotive industry for a variety of applications, including exhaust systems, fuel lines, and hydraulic systems.
